Saturday 20th June

A Red Kite was just south of Ravenscar early this morning, and one flew south over Cayton Low Road later in the morning. Highlights from South Cliff include 24 Crossbills, 31 Siskins and 104 Swifts flying south, plus 1 Crossbill, and 18 Swifts flying north. 639 Swifts and 2 Siskins were also seen heading south past Long Nab. 5 Crossbills flew south over Whin Bank early morning, and 26 more flew over at 12:30. At Johnson's Marsh there were 12 Herons, 2 Teal, 2 Shelduck and 20+ House Martins, while 2 Kestrels, a Buzzard and a Greylag flew over south. A Hobby flew east, low over Heron Lane this afternoon, and another was seen flying over Woodall Avenue. A Cuckoo was spotted on Jugger Howe Moor. A Green Woodpecker and 2 Marsh Tits were at Wilton Heights this evening.
